Survey Results
Q1 I wanted to get an idea of the
age the people were who took
my survey. 80% of people who
took my survey were between
the ages of 13-18 which was a
good amount because this age
range is my target audience. It’s
still helpful that I’ve got a wider
age range because there will
also be people outside the
target age range who will
purchase the magazine.

Q4
50% so half of the people I
surveyed liked Indie Pop, as
this was the most popular I
decided to make my
magazine more based
around Indie Pop.
Q5 A lot of people
considered the price,
18/20 people who took
this survey said ‘Yes’.
So I made sure that the
price of my magazine
was affordable and I
made the price of the
magazine not stand out
as much on the
magazine so it wasn’t
one of the first things
people notice.
Q6
If possible everyone
would pay the minimum
amount, this is obvious.
And the maximum
amount people would pay
is between the £2.50-
3.49. I think I want to
question my target
audience more about the
price.
Q7
The two most popular were ‘Interviews being included inside’ and
‘Information on festivals and gigs.’ So I’ll make sure that these two
features will make up quite a bit of my magazine. Also freebies
encouraged a lot of people so I might include free posters within
my magazine.
Q8 Around 40% of people sometimes buy music magazines, with
a small amount of only 15% buying them weekly. As 40% of
people buy them sometimes and 25% of people buying them
monthly I’m going to make my magazine a monthly issue.
Q9
65% of people were interested in seeing new upcoming artists
being shown on the front cover and featured inside the
magazine. I was happy this is what my target audience wanted
because my magazine ‘Promo’ is about promoting new artists.
If the option for well-known artists was more popular I would
have had to chance the concept of my idea.
Q10
Most people get their music from online
stores such as iTunes.
Q11 Most people access new music and
interviews online so at the end of my article
in my magazine I added a point saying you
can find out more information online.
Q12 A massive 90% of people attend festivals
and gigs so I need to ensure I include
information about festivals and gigs in my
magazine.
